A Minnesota woman’s mugshot has gone viral after social media users noticed her striking resemblance to Jennifer Lopez.
Cyrena Anne Quast, 35, was arrested on August 30 after allegedly stealing power tool batteries from a store in Monticello, Minnesota.
However, it was Quast’s Wright County Sheriff’s Office booking photo that attracted the most attention, with stunned viewers comparing her to J.Lo.

Jennifer Lopez lookalike accused of stealing $580 in batteries
According to a criminal complaint obtained by The Watch MN, Quast took two double packs of power tool batteries worth approximately $580.
An employee reportedly recognized her from another theft at the store two days earlier and supplied police with a description of her vehicle and its license plate.
Wright County Sheriff’s OfficeQuast admitted taking the batteries after she was located by police. Online arrest records show that she was booked on a gross misdemeanor theft charge and released the following day.

Records show the J.Lo lookalike has previously been arrested for other offenses including drug possession, DWI, fleeing police and providing false identification, along with several traffic violations.
